Part 1 and Part 2

The results for the Part 1 backup exam and for the main Part 2 exam were released on Friday 27 November as planned. There was an IT issue which caused a delay to the release of those results on the day, and MRCP(UK) staff worked extremely hard to address it, so that all results were released on the day albeit later than we had hoped. We sincerely apologise to all candidates who were affected by this.

The next Part 1 diet will take place on 12 January 2021, as a hybrid of paper and remote online proctored formats. All places for the online exam will be finalised this week, and unfortunately it will not be possible to change from paper to online after this due to the logistics of registering candidates for the online exam by our online provider. The date for the backup exam for this diet (which will be offered to candidates affected by late written centre cancellations or by technical issues with the online exam) will be announced soon.

The Part 2 online backup exam, for UK candidates sitting the October exam who had their venue places cancelled or who experienced significant technical issues during the online exam, will run this week on 8 December.

The next diet of Part 2 will take place on 23 March 2021. This is again planned to be run in hybrid form (both paper and online formats) in the UK and selected international centres. The application window will open on 11 January.

Specialty Certificate Exams / European Specialty Exams

The SCE in Endocrinology & Diabetes and the European Board Examination in Endocrincology, Diabetes and Metabolism (EBEEDM) will run this week on 9 December.

All SCE / ESE exams for 2021 are currently planned to run as scheduled, in Pearson Vue centres; details for each specialty can be found here.

Dates for SCE / ESE backup exams will be published shortly, as soon as these are finalised and confirmed.
